Wednesday Morning Women's Hike at Hill of Life!
1710 Camp Craft Rd, Austin, TX 78746, USA, Austin, TX, USJoin us at Hill of Life Trail for a refreshing hike to start your morning outside and get your body moving in nature! This is a quicker, 75-minute hike focused primarily on hiking, fresh air, and enjoying the trail with a community of women who love the outdoors.
Hill of Life is a well-known Austin trail with rocky terrain and several uphill and steeper sections. We’ll move at a steady, supportive pace, and sturdy hiking shoes with good tread are strongly recommended. This weekday hike is less focused on guided mindfulness than our longer weekend hikes and is more about simply getting outside and hiking.
Women of all ages and backgrounds are welcome!

Join us for a life-changing women's adventure exploring the desert and mountains of Far West Texas alongside an intimate and supportive group of growth-oriented women. We'll fill our days hiking the other-worldly landscape of Big Bend National Park, relishing in self-care practices like meditation, mindful movement and sound healing, and spend our evenings reflecting, rejuvenating and stargazing under some of the darkest night skies in the lower 48-states. Join us on a deeply transformational journey as we cultivate our personal empowerment and connect with this rarely visited corner of the world, with ourselves, and with one another.Our Home in Big Bend:
Throughout the retreat we will have exclusive use of a beautiful and historically restored boutique hotel overlooking the Chisos Mountains and the ghost town of Terlingua, Texas, just minutes from the entrance of Big Bend National Park. Surrounded by a million acres of state and national parks, our accommodations have extraordinary views for soaking in the magic of the mountains, stars, and desert.
Lovingly designed and built in harmony with the surrounding nature, the hotel is a rustic desert oasis with intricate stone and tile work, tin roofs, handcrafted doors, cane and sotol stalk ceilings, stone fireplaces, large terraces and courtyards, fire pits and a dreamy outdoor kitchen with views. After long days of hiking, the property is equipped with all the amenities necessary so you can relax in total comfort while connecting with nature. With views in every direction, we will also get to take in amazing sunrises and sunsets each day.
Our location is walkable to all of Terlingua's Ghost Town, making it the perfect gateway for explorations during free time.What's Included:
